Bahía Thetis Essentials

Bahía Thetis Essentials

This collection highlights the landmarks of Ushuaia and the Tierra del Fuego archipelago. It features the Tierra del Fuego National Park, where the Pan-American Highway ends at Bahía Lapataia, and the historic Southern Fuegian Railway. Cultural sites include the former prison—now the Maritime Museum—and the Acatushún Museum’s collection of marine skeletons. Natural highlights include the turquoise Laguna Esmeralda, the Martial Glacier, and the remote San Juan de Salvamento lighthouse on Isla de los Estados, which served as the inspiration for Jules Verne’s literature.

Mountain Peaks

Mountain Peaks

This collection highlights the rugged summits of the southernmost Andes in Tierra del Fuego, ranging from the jagged silhouette of Monte Olivia near Ushuaia to the remote peaks of the Mitre Peninsula. It includes Monte Bove, the highest point on Isla de los Estados, and Cerro Castor, the world's southernmost ski mountain. These landmarks define a sub-Antarctic landscape of ancient glacial formations and steep, rocky terrain characteristic of the remote Fuegian wilderness.

Glaciers & Alpine Lakes

This collection highlights the glacial landscapes and high-altitude lakes of the Tierra del Fuego archipelago. Centered around the Martial Mountains and Sierra Alvear range near Ushuaia, these sites feature turquoise meltwater basins and hanging glaciers. Notable locations include Laguna Esmeralda, fed by the Ojo del Albino glacier, and the expansive Lago Fagnano, which sits atop the Magallanes-Fagnano tectonic fault. These landmarks demonstrate the region's dramatic sub-antarctic geology and its vital role in the local watershed.
